Macbook trackpad jumpy, behaves as though following a grid

I am just now installing Linux for the first time; everything has been going smoothly with the notable exception of my trackpad. When using the trackpad (external mice work perfectly fine) the cursor tends to jump around in an odd way. It does not move smoothly; it jumps along its intended path in increments every so often. Also, the cursor seems not to enjoy being moved diagonally. It only moves in the four cardinal directions. If I move my finger diagonally, it simply alternates between moving vertically and horizontally. Any help?
